**Essential Duties And Responsibilities**
* Maintains all records pertaining to the receipt, storage, and disposition of all property and evidence;
* Maintains and accurate inventory of all property and evidence;
* Disposes of all property and evidence in accordance with all state laws and agency policy and procedures;
* Coordinates the process of transporting evidence to the crime lab;
* The supervision of personnel assigned to the unit;
* Enforces agency policy and procedure for evidence/property storage.
* Handles items of evidence and property, to show continuity of the chain of custody and security;
* Performs routine clerical work; duties may include logging in materials and documents, entering data and information into computerized files, filing and retrieving materials from manual or computerized filing system, typing correspondence, memos and other documents, and sorting documents.
* Operates a computer, typewriter, calculator, photocopier, facsimile, and other office equipment.
* Operates a City vehicle when necessary.

**Job Scope**
The purpose of this position is to manage the property and evidence obtained by Union City Police Personnel and to ensure its safe handling, safe keeping and proper disposition. The property and evidence custodian is exposed to various incident settings and must rely upon previous training and experience in the application of procedure. Errors in the work can jeopardize property and hinder the successful prosecution of offenders.

* Job has recurring work situations involving moderate degrees of discretion. The need for accuracy and effective utilization of accepted programs and procedures is high. Errors in judgment and execution will waste time and resources adversely impacting unit performance. Incumbent operates independently but work is verified by supervision.

**Minimum Qualifications**
High school diploma or equivalent; Associate’s degree preferred; valid Georgia Driver’s license; US citizen ; at least 21 years of age. Successful completion of the pre\-employment process which includes written exam, oral interview, background check, criminal records and traffic history check, medical and drug screening, polygraph evaluation, successful completion of Police Academy; equivalent combination of education and experience.
